#e186ad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e186ad is composed of 88.2% red, 52.5%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.4% magenta, 23.1%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 334.3 degrees, a saturation of 60.3% and a lightness of 70.4%. #e186ad color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c30d5b.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#e186ad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e186ad has RGB values of R:225, G:134, B:173 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.23,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14780077.

Shades and Tints of #e186ad
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050103 is the darkest color, while #fcf4f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e186ad
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b8afb3 is the less saturated color, while #fe69a9 is the most saturated one.
